When to Schedule Lawn Aeration in Holly Springs, Georgia – Seasonal Guide
In Holly Springs, Georgia, the best time to schedule lawn aeration is typically during the late spring or early fall. These periods align with the region’s warm-season grasses, such as Bermuda and Zoysia, which thrive when aerated as they enter their peak growing cycles. The local climate, characterized by humid summers and mild winters, means that aeration is most effective when soil temperatures are warm but not excessively hot, and when the risk of frost has passed—usually after mid-April and before late October.
Neighborhoods like Harmony on the Lakes and the areas surrounding Barrett Park often experience compacted clay soils and varying shade coverage from mature trees. These factors, combined with Holly Springs’ occasional drought spells and heavy summer rains, make timing crucial for optimal results. Homeowners should also consider local environmental factors such as municipal watering restrictions and the unique microclimates created by proximity to landmarks like J.B. Owens Park. Holly Springs Red Clay Compaction and Core Aeration Depth Requirements
Holly Springs, Georgia sits within the Piedmont physiographic region, where soils are dominated by Cecil and Appling series red clay loams — dense, acidic Ultisols that compact readily under foot traffic, equipment loads, and seasonal rainfall. According to the USDA Web Soil Survey, these soils typically exhibit low permeability and high clay content, making compaction a persistent challenge for residential and commercial turf. Core aeration — the mechanical removal of soil plugs — is the most effective remediation method for these conditions. Recommended aeration depths for Piedmont clay soils range from 2.5 to 4 inches, with plug spacing of 2 to 3 inches for heavily compacted areas. Property owners should assess the following indicators before scheduling service:
- Pooling water after moderate rainfall events
- Visible soil cracking during dry periods
- Turf thinning in high-traffic zones
- Thatch accumulation exceeding 0.5 inches
UGA Cooperative Extension recommends soil testing prior to aeration to determine pH and nutrient availability, as Cecil series soils often require lime amendments to correct acidity before overseeding.
Optimal Aeration Timing for Holly Springs's Warm-Season Turf
Holly Springs falls within USDA Plant Hardiness Zone 7b, as confirmed by the USDA Plant Hardiness Zone Map, with average minimum winter temperatures ranging from 5°F to 10°F. The city's predominant warm-season turf grasses — Bermudagrass, Zoysiagrass, and Centipedegrass — require aeration during active growth periods to ensure rapid plug decomposition and root recovery. Based on UGA Cooperative Extension guidance for North Georgia Piedmont conditions, the recommended aeration windows are:
- Bermudagrass: Late May through mid-July, when soil temperatures consistently exceed 65°F
- Zoysiagrass: Late May through June, avoiding late-season stress periods
- Centipedegrass: Late May through early June only, as this species is sensitive to late-summer disruption
- Tall Fescue (cool-season): Late August through October, aligned with fall renovation windows
The National Weather Service Peachtree City forecast office serves the Holly Springs area and provides soil temperature trend data useful for timing decisions. Aeration performed outside these windows risks turf injury, weed encroachment, and incomplete plug breakdown in compacted clay soils.
Protecting Holly Springs Stormwater Infrastructure During Lawn Aeration
Lawn aeration in Holly Springs generates soil cores that, if not managed properly, can migrate into storm drains, roadside ditches, and drainage swales during rainfall events. The Holly Springs Stormwater Management program oversees the city's drainage infrastructure and enforces water quality standards consistent with the Clean Water Act and the EPA NPDES Program. Property owners and service providers should observe the following practices to prevent stormwater violations:
- Allow soil cores to dry in place for 48 to 72 hours before breaking them up with a mower or rake
- Do not blow or sweep cores into street gutters, curb inlets, or drainage ditches
- Avoid aerating within 10 feet of storm drain inlets without containment measures
- Refrain from aerating immediately before forecasted rainfall events exceeding 0.5 inches
The Georgia EPD Watershed Protection Branch establishes water quality standards applicable to municipal stormwater systems throughout Cherokee County. Sediment discharge from residential lawn activities, including aeration debris, may constitute a violation of local stormwater ordinances. Residents near drainage corridors or detention ponds should exercise additional caution.

Aeration Practices Near Holly Springs Creeks, Buffers, and Wooded Corridors
Holly Springs contains several stream corridors and wooded drainage features, including tributaries flowing toward Little River and other Cherokee County waterways. Properties adjacent to these corridors are subject to stream buffer requirements under Georgia's Erosion and Sedimentation Act and local ordinances administered through Holly Springs Community Development. While lawn aeration is generally a low-disturbance activity, properties near stream buffers should observe the following precautions:
- Confirm the location of any applicable 25-foot or 50-foot stream buffer before operating aeration equipment near wooded edges or drainage swales
- Avoid aerating on slopes greater than 15 percent where loosened soil cores may erode toward water features
- Do not apply post-aeration fertilizer or lime within buffer zones without verifying local setback requirements
- Consult Georgia EPD Water Conservation guidance when planning nutrient applications following aeration near sensitive areas
The Holly Springs Code Enforcement division investigates property maintenance violations, including erosion and sediment issues that may arise from improper lawn care practices near drainage features. Property owners in wooded or creek-adjacent lots should verify buffer boundaries through the Community Development office before scheduling aeration on sloped or riparian-adjacent turf areas.

Post-Aeration Overseeding and Soil Amendment Standards in Holly Springs
Core aeration creates an ideal seedbed for overseeding and soil amendment applications, and timing these inputs correctly is essential for turf recovery in Holly Springs's Piedmont clay conditions. Following aeration, property owners should implement the following sequence based on UGA Cooperative Extension recommendations for Cherokee County:
- Soil testing: Submit samples to the UGA Extension soil laboratory before applying lime or fertilizer; Cecil series soils frequently require pH correction to the 6.0–6.5 range
- Lime application: Apply dolomitic lime at rates specified by soil test results, typically 40–80 pounds per 1,000 square feet for acidic Piedmont soils
- Overseeding: Broadcast seed immediately after aeration while cores are still moist; press seed into plug holes for improved soil contact
- Starter fertilizer: Apply phosphorus-based starter fertilizer at label rates; avoid excess nitrogen applications near storm drains
Fertilizer applications in Georgia are regulated under the Georgia Fertilizer Act of 1997, which establishes labeling and content standards for commercially sold products. Property owners should retain product labels and application records, particularly when managing turf near drainage-sensitive areas identified by Holly Springs Stormwater Management.
What Neighborhoods Do We Serve Throughout Holly Springs, GA?
- Harmony on the Lakes: A large master-planned community with varied lot sizes, detention pond adjacency, and Bermudagrass-dominant turf; aeration timing and stormwater precautions near pond edges are particularly relevant in this area.
- Hickory Flat Corridor: Transitional residential and commercial lots along the Hickory Flat Road corridor with compacted fill soils common in newer construction; deep core aeration is frequently necessary to penetrate graded subsoil layers.
- Canton Highway Subdivisions: Established neighborhoods with mature tree canopy and mixed Zoysiagrass and Tall Fescue lawns; shaded turf areas require adjusted aeration frequency and overseeding with shade-tolerant cultivars.
- Holly Springs Town Center Area: Newer mixed-use and residential development with urban fill soils and limited topsoil depth; aeration depths should be calibrated to avoid disrupting shallow utility lines common in recently developed parcels.
- Avery Park and Adjacent Subdivisions: Residential areas with moderate slopes and wooded rear lots draining toward creek corridors; post-aeration erosion precautions are advisable on grades exceeding 10 percent.
- Sixes Road Communities: Established subdivisions with older compacted clay profiles and significant thatch accumulation; annual aeration combined with dethatching is commonly recommended by UGA Extension for this soil and turf profile.
